Bombas is a comfort focused premium basics brand with a mission to help those in need. The company launched in 2013, after the founders learned that socks are the #1 most requested clothing item at homeless shelters. From there, they set out to solve that problem, donating a pair of socks for every pair they sell. How do you donate a lot of socks? You sell a lot. And how do you sell a lot? You make the most comfortable socks in the history of feet. Millions of pairs sold and donated later, Bombas has continued to innovate within its mission and product, introducing new socks, as well as underwear and t-shirts, the #2 and #3 most requested clothing items at homeless shelters, all while continuing to make a positive impact on the community where we all work and live.

About the Role

Dow Jones Risk & Compliance is a global provider of third-party risk management and regulatory compliance solutions. We deliver data, research tools and services to help our clients meet anti-money laundering, anti-bribery, anti-corruption and economic sanctions regulations and mitigate third-party risk.

You will join a team of multilingual experts who research, record and update details on individuals and entities mentioned in Sanctions & Other Official Lists (Special Lists) issued by government bodies and regulators around the world, for example, the Office of Foreign Assets Control in the US, national law enforcement bodies or securities regulators as well as for other Risk & Compliance contents. You will report to the Manager, Sanctions & Other Official Lists. You will be based in Barcelona

You Will:

+ Create and update profiles of individuals and entities mentioned in Sanctions & Other Official Lists (Special Lists) and quality check their information by continually monitoring and analysing relevant publicly available sources as well as data on Dow Jones owned products and specific directories

+ Research and extract relevant data adhering to team guidelines

+ Ensure that profiles are complete, accurate and up-to-date

+ Respond in writing to clients’ questions about Special Lists content

+ Monitor changes in sanctions, counter-terrorism financing and anti-money laundering regulations

+ Write due diligence reports on companies and/or individuals as required and contribute to other projects

+ Support R&C with translation services as and when required

+ Contribute to workflow improvements and tool efficiencies

+ Work urgently to complete key sanctions updates for Dow Jones clients as needed
